Exam Revision in Jeopardy: Cyberattack Cripples Edinburgh Council Systems
Edinburgh, Scotland – October 26, 2023 – Chaos has erupted in Edinburgh as a major cyberattack has crippled the city council's IT systems, leaving thousands of students facing potential disruption to their exam revision. The attack, the severity of which is still unfolding, has left crucial council services, including online learning platforms and vital exam administration systems, inaccessible. This raises serious concerns about the fairness and smooth running of upcoming exams for students across the city.
The attack, which sources suggest began late Tuesday evening, has resulted in widespread system outages. Council officials confirmed the incident this morning, stating that they are working with cybersecurity experts and law enforcement to investigate the nature and extent of the breach. However, the impact on students preparing for vital exams is already being felt.
<h3>Impact on Students and Exam Preparation</h3>
The timing of the attack couldn't be worse. With crucial exams looming, many students rely on online resources provided by the Edinburgh Council, including digital copies of past papers, revision materials, and online learning platforms. The inaccessibility of these resources is causing widespread anxiety and frustration among students and parents alike.
- Loss of Access to Revision Materials: Students report being unable to access vital revision materials stored on council servers. This includes essential documents, online study guides, and practice tests.
- Disruption to Online Learning Platforms: The cyberattack has taken down crucial online learning platforms, leaving students unable to access important information and support from teachers.
- Uncertainty Regarding Exam Administration: Concerns are mounting about the potential disruption to exam scheduling, registration processes, and the overall administration of the exams themselves.
"It's incredibly stressful," said Sarah Jenkins, a 17-year-old student preparing for her final exams. "I rely heavily on the council's online resources for revision, and now I can't access anything. It's unfair and completely disruptive."
<h3>Council Response and Ongoing Investigation</h3>
Edinburgh City Council has issued a statement acknowledging the severity of the situation and assuring the public that they are working diligently to restore services as quickly as possible. They have emphasized their commitment to ensuring the fairness and smooth running of upcoming exams, despite the significant challenges posed by the cyberattack.
However, the council has not yet provided a timeline for the restoration of full system functionality, leaving students and parents in a state of uncertainty. The nature of the cyberattack and the perpetrators remain unknown, although investigations are underway by both council IT teams and the police. The council is urging anyone with information to come forward.
<h3>Potential Long-Term Consequences</h3>
The long-term consequences of this cyberattack extend beyond immediate exam disruption. The breach could potentially expose sensitive student data, raising concerns about privacy and security. Furthermore, the financial cost of recovering from such an attack will be substantial, placing further strain on council resources.
This incident highlights the increasing vulnerability of public institutions to cyberattacks and the need for robust cybersecurity measures. It also underscores the importance of having contingency plans in place to mitigate the impact of such events on essential services.
